Evolution of Microphone Technology Leading to AI Integration

Traditional studio condenser microphones have historically focused on sound fidelity, low self-noise, and durability. Over recent years, features like multiple polar patterns and higher SPL handling have been added. The move toward AI-enhanced microphones in 2026 builds upon this foundation, utilizing machine learning to address persistent issues such as background noise and inconsistent sound quality. Previously, improvements centered on hardware enhancements; now, software-based AI capabilities are becoming integral to microphone design. This evolution reflects broader trends in audio technology, where AI is increasingly used to optimize performance and user experience.

Key Questions

Are AI-enhanced microphones suitable for professional studio use?

Initial assessments suggest these microphones may meet professional standards, particularly regarding noise reduction and vocal clarity. However, comprehensive evaluations are ongoing, and some users may prefer traditional models for critical recording tasks until more data is available.

How do AI microphones differ from traditional models?

AI microphones utilize machine learning algorithms that analyze and adjust sound parameters in real-time, offering potentially superior noise suppression and sound optimization compared to static hardware features.

Will AI features increase the cost of studio microphones?

It is possible that the integration of AI technology may lead to higher retail prices due to added complexity and development costs. The performance benefits, however, could justify the investment for many users.

Can existing microphones be upgraded with AI capabilities?

Most current models are unlikely to be retrofitted with AI features. Manufacturers are expected to release new models with these capabilities, and some firmware updates may enhance existing products, but hardware upgrades are generally limited.

What are the main benefits of AI microphones for content creators?

Content creators may experience clearer, more professional recordings with less editing, especially in environments with challenging acoustics. AI-driven noise reduction and adaptive sound profiles can facilitate higher-quality audio production.
